Saeujeot

Quite a few examples of fermented foods contain Saeujeot (Korean salted fermented shrimp), kimchi (Korean fermented cabbage), and Dongbaekha (white shrimp harvested in February and April). These foods are common in Korea, in which They are really used to taste soups and steamed eggs. Nevertheless, the standard of these foods is dependent upon the type of shrimp harvested And just how new They may be.

A analyze was done to find out the results of different salt concentrations on saeujeot fermentation. 4 sets of samples were being well prepared with unique salt concentrations and have been incubated at 15degC for 142 days. Amino acid and metabolite concentrations were identified. On top of that, the bacterial Local community was studied to determine the outcome of various salt concentrations within the bacterial successions.

The bacterial community altered in the fermentation period of time, with quite possibly the most rapid modifications taking place through the early stages. The bacterial abundances were being believed working with qPCR, plus the bacterial 16S rRNA gene copy figures improved over the early stages of fermentation. The bacterial 16S rRNA gene copy number enhanced from one.3x10 8 copies/ml to 8.8x10 nine copies/ml. The bacterial proteinase activity was weak in samples that had been subjected to superior salt concentrations.

The bacterial metabolite concentrations have been much like Those people located in samples that were not subjected to substantial salt concentrations. Acetate, TMAO, and lactate were being determined as the major organic and natural compounds. Nonetheless, these compounds were not present in all samples.

Archaea, Proteobacteria, and Firmicutes dominated in the course of the initial stage fermented foods meaning from the fermentation, although the Proteobacteria remained dominant in the progressing levels. The presence of Archaea may possibly reveal that these groups contributed a lot more to jeotgal fermentation beneath significant salt circumstances than the bacterial users.
